Camp Pendleton’s Criminal Investigation Division (CID) presented a newly designed crime prevention seminar to Marine Wing Support Squadron 372 at the South Mesa Lodge, March 6.
The brief is intended to inform the base units on how to identify and prevent criminal activity on Camp Pendleton.
According to the CID Web site, their goal is to conduct preliminary investigations on all complaints regarding criminal offenses to determine if, in fact, a crime has been committed.
